WebMesh definition The TLM solver uses the same hexahedral mesh as the Transient solver, but has different default values since the TLM solver sometimes needs a finer mesh to capture the geometry accurately. To compensate for the increased mesh fineness the TLM solver employs an octreebased meshing algorithm to reduce the overall cell count. http://www.edatop.com/cst/CST2013/28651.html WebCST STUDIO SUITE ® 2024 – High Frequency Simulation 73 Time Domain Solver In CST STUDIO SUITE two high frequency time domain solvers are available, which both work on hexahedral meshes. One is based on the Finite Integration Technique (FIT), just called Transient solver, the second one is based on the Transmission-Line Method (TLM) and …
